Push-Pull Closure

A Push-pull closure means that the cap will either open fully or partially to give access to either end of the bottle. Push-pull closures are typically the plastic caps that allow for easy opening or partial closure for easy pulling or pushing down to close. They are most often used on PET bottles, HDPE & metal bottles. For the plastic caps, they are available in a wide variety, including clear push-pull, foil push-pull, solid white push-pull, and the ever so popular custom push-pull.
